Buying Guide
When you're looking at mouse pads with wrist rests, you need to think about how you actually use your mouse. If you tend to pivot from your wrist a lot, a rest like this can help keep it straight and supported, reducing strain. But if you're supposed to be moving your whole arm, a rest might actually encourage bad habits. Pay attention to the materials, especially the wrist rest, because memory foam will feel different than gel and will wear differently over time. Also, consider the size; a 12 x 8-inch pad is standard, but if you make big mouse movements, you might feel cramped.
Ergonomic Design (8-degree slope, massage protrusion)
This isn't just a bump; the 8-degree slope and little massage bumps are designed to keep your wrist in a more natural, slightly elevated position, like how your hand rests comfortably on a pillow, which helps blood flow and takes pressure off your carpal tunnel.
Memory Foam Wrist Rest
Think of memory foam like a custom-molded cushion for your wrist. It softens with your body heat and pressure, adapting to your shape to provide personalized support, unlike a rigid rest that might create pressure points.
Non-slip PU Base
This is crucial so your mouse pad doesn't slide around like a hockey puck when you're trying to make precise movements. A good non-slip base keeps everything anchored, so your focus stays on your screen, not on repositioning your pad.
